I never head wax/ sealant streaking, untill last time I waxed my car.
I waxed my car while sun setting, getting dark,
and it started to rain after few hours apparently.
I wonder if that rain caused wax to streaks....
do i have to keep my car away from water for few hours ever after buff off all the waxes?
dlc95
10-05-2015, 10:07 PM
I've only ever had it streak if I over applied it in certain spots.
Some sealants recommend not getting them wet for a few hours.
